Why Trail Runners Need Secure Lacing Systems

Trail running involves constant micro-adjustments as the foot encounters uneven surfaces, rocks, and roots. Traditional laces often loosen over time due to the repetitive motion and the friction of the trail, leading to heel slippage. A secure, non-slip locking system ensures the foot remains centered on the midsole, which is critical for balance and preventing blisters.

Beyond simple security, these systems are a safety feature. Tripping over an untied lace on a technical descent can result in significant injury. By removing the possibility of loose laces, the runner can focus entirely on foot placement and trail obstacles.

Lastly, foot swelling is a physiological reality during long runs in the heat. Elastic systems accommodate this expansion automatically, whereas traditional fabric laces remain static and can cause discomfort. A locking system provides the dynamic adaptability required for long-term comfort on the trail.

Installing Lace Locks: A Quick Step-by-Step

Installation is generally a simple process that requires only a pair of scissors and a few minutes. First, remove the original laces from the shoe entirely. Lace the new system through the eyelets just as you would with traditional laces, making sure the tension is loose enough to allow for easy entry.

Once the system is threaded, put the shoe on to gauge the desired tension. Tighten the lock or adjust the knot/bumps while the foot is inside the shoe to ensure it is not too tight. Stand up and walk around, checking for any pressure points across the top of the foot.

Once satisfied with the fit, trim the excess lace, leaving an extra inch or two just in case. Seal the cut ends with a flame or the provided clips to prevent fraying. Ensure the locking mechanism is secured properly before heading out onto the trail for the first time.

Can I transfer these laces between different shoes? Most locking systems can be transferred, but systems like Xpand or those that require cutting/trimming are typically permanent. If you swap shoes frequently, choose a system that does not require trimming.

Do these systems work for all shoe brands? Yes, almost all locking systems are designed to fit the standard eyelet spacing found on modern trail running shoes. Always check for compatibility with very small or unusually shaped eyelets before installation.

Are these systems allowed in trail races? Yes, no-tie lacing systems are universally permitted in all competitive trail and ultramarathon events. They are considered an essential gear upgrade rather than a performance enhancement.

How do I maintain these laces? Most systems require little maintenance, but rinsing them with fresh water after a muddy run will extend their lifespan. Avoid using harsh chemicals, which can degrade the elastic properties of the bungee cords over time.
